Ubuntu 8.04 LTS Beta released

The Ubuntu team is pleased to announce the beta release of Ubuntu 8.04 LTS(Long-Term Support) on desktop and server. Codenamed "Hardy Heron", 8.04LTS continues Ubuntu's proud tradition of integrating the latest andgreatest open source technologies into a high-quality, easy-to-use Linuxdistribution...

Will Bush n Vice Cheney attack Iran before their time is up?

White House Watch - Are We Closer to War?The abrupt resignation yesterday of the top U.S. commander in the Middle East, Admiral William J. "Fox" Fallon, has sparked a new round of speculation that President Bush and Vice President Cheney have some sort of plan in the works to attack Iran before their time is up.
